Stress and interruptions are not only caused by the useless talks, but also by the many requests for the exchange of goods. In principle, the purpose of the game is to develop a city through all the ages, from the simple Stone Age, Bronze Age or Iron Age to the metropolis of the Contemporary Era, and even in the coming ages. For the buildings in the city that you build, you need a variety of goods, and for those that you have not, has been set up the so-called Market, where players can change their goods. There is a special button you can reach the Market (visible in the picture below), but many players did not understand the usefulness of that button and post their offers on the guild chat, thus increasing the stress on other members. „It’s like you’re starting to call your friends and tell them, for example, that you have some potatoes and you want some carrots; It would not be surprising if you wake up with some jokes from friends, who would certainly say you would go to the market”, say the unhappy. Another idiosyncrasy is the duty to „help” those who have legendary buildings at the construction stage, although the help you are obliged to give can not be called „help”, but „obligation”, and the spirit of the game is different . You have many possibilities to help other players, but you also have the opportunity to get rewards for your help. For example, if you help someone build a legendary building, you can get both points and medals as well as plans for your own legendary buildings, plans without which you can not build. But only those in the top 4 or 5 places in the donors’ rankings can get those rewards, so the player has to appreciate whether or not it is appropriate to give help. But guilds force you, through so-called circulars or DNLs, to give help against your will, even if you can not get that reward, well thought by the founders of the game.
